1990 MARVEL UNIVERSE DOCTOR OCTOPUS #59 - PSA 9

PSA

$24.00 
SKU: 84998869

Limit: 1

Year: 1990
Brand: MARVEL UNIVERSE
Subject: DOCTOR OCTOPUS
Variety:
Card Number: 59
Grade: PSA 9
Total Population: 311
Population Higher: 213